Pydroid 3 - IDE for Python 3
![]() |
Ultima versión | 7.4_arm64 |
![]() |
Actualizar | Jan,13/2025 |
![]() |
Desarrollador | IIEC |
![]() |
SO | Android 6.0+ |
![]() |
Categoría | Educación |
![]() |
Tamaño | 74.9 MB |
![]() |
Google PlayStore | ![]() |
Etiquetas: | Educación |



Pydroid 3: El IDE definitivo de Python 3 para Android
Pydroid 3 es el IDE de Python 3 más potente y fácil de usar disponible en Google Play, diseñado con fines educativos. Esta aplicación integral ofrece una amplia gama de funciones para mejorar su experiencia de aprendizaje de Python, todo dentro de un conveniente entorno de Android.
Características clave:
- Intérprete de Python 3 sin conexión: Ejecuta programas de Python sin conexión a Internet.
- Pip Package Manager y repositorio personalizado: Instale paquetes fácilmente, incluidas bibliotecas científicas mejoradas como NumPy, SciPy, Matplotlib, Scikit-learn y Jupyter (con paquetes de ruedas prediseñados para una compatibilidad mejorada). También se incluye compatibilidad con OpenCV (en dispositivos con Camera2 API). *
- Marcos de aprendizaje profundo: Compatibilidad con TensorFlow y PyTorch. *
- Soporte GUI: Soporte completo de Tkinter para crear interfaces gráficas de usuario.
- Emulador de terminal: Un emulador de terminal robusto con soporte de línea de lectura (a través de pip).
- Compiladores integrados: Compile código C, C y Fortran directamente dentro de la aplicación, lo que permite la creación de bibliotecas con componentes de código nativo. La gestión de dependencias se simplifica con el acceso a la línea de comandos.
- Herramientas de desarrollo avanzadas: Compatibilidad con Cython, depurador de PDB (con puntos de interrupción y vigilancia), biblioteca gráfica Kivy (con backend SDL2) y compatibilidad con PySide6 (disponible a través del repositorio de instalación rápida, incluida la compatibilidad con Matplotlib PySide6) . También se incluye compatibilidad con pygame 2.
- Potente editor: Disfrute de funciones como predicción de código, sangría automática, análisis de código en tiempo real, un teclado especializado, resaltado de sintaxis, temas, pestañas y navegación de código mejorada. *
- Compartir fácilmente: Comparte tu código sin esfuerzo a través de Pastebin con un solo clic.
*Las funciones premium requieren una actualización de la versión premium.
Uso y requisitos del sistema:
Pydroid 3 requiere al menos 250 MB de Internal storage gratuito (se recomiendan 300 MB). Las bibliotecas más pesadas como SciPy requieren más espacio. La depuración implica establecer puntos de interrupción haciendo clic en los números de línea. Bibliotecas específicas (Kivy, PySide6, SDL2, Tkinter, pygame) se detectan a través de declaraciones o comentarios de importación específicos (#Pydroid run kivy
, #Pydroid run qt
, etc.). Utilice #Pydroid run terminal
para forzar el modo terminal (útil para Matplotlib).
Licencia de biblioteca premium:
Ciertas bibliotecas requieren una licencia premium debido a las complejidades que implica su portabilidad. Estos se proporcionan bajo acuerdo con otro desarrollador. Se aceptan bifurcaciones gratuitas de estas bibliotecas.
Contribuyendo a Pydroid 3:
Informar errores o sugerir funciones para ayudar a mejorar Pydroid 3.
Información legal:
Algunos binarios tienen licencia (L)GPL; Póngase en contacto con los desarrolladores para obtener el código fuente. Las bibliotecas Python puras con licencia GPL ya se consideran en forma de código fuente. Pydroid 3 no incluye automáticamente módulos nativos con licencia GPL (como GNU readline, instalable mediante pip).
El código de muestra proporcionado es solo para uso educativo y no se puede utilizar en productos de la competencia. Póngase en contacto con los desarrolladores si no está seguro acerca de las restricciones de uso.
Android es una marca comercial de Google Inc.